What is an Electric Vehicle Design Course?

The process of designing automobiles powered by electrical power as opposed to internal combustion engines is electric vehicle design. It involves all such factors as designing the chassis, calculating battery power, and choosing all the right components such as a motor, DC-DC converter, onboard charger, and lithium-ion battery.

The electric vehicle design course is done with the same optimization goals as any other automobile design. Making it energy-efficient, sustainable, and comfort-friendly for customers is all part of the design gamut. However, electric vehicle design also involves certain other factors such as powertrain design, battery design, thermal management, and software integration. The chassis and body design is done to fit the electric motor and battery.

Given that electric vehicles are going to be more common in the future, a design course to make them more user-friendly was a long time coming.

Here are some of the key highlights:

1. Aerodynamics

The aerodynamics of an electric vehicle is important to minimize energy loss and maximize efficiency. Low-drag design features such as sloped roofs and optimized underbody designs help in this regard.

2. Software

Due to an electric vehicle’s electronic design system, advanced software algorithms manage most components such as power distribution, regenerative braking, and driving modes. An EV usually also contains more sophisticated infotainment, navigation, and stereo systems, all of which can be easily managed with software.

3. User Experience

Focus on areas such as sustainability of materials, efficient manufacturing methods, space efficiency, noise reduction, and an overall upgrade in comfort. These are a must-learn in any electric vehicle design course.

4. Sustainability

The design phase of an electric vehicle will always consider the many ways to reduce environmental pollution. It must ensure that all the materials used are sustainable and production-efficient so that it helps preserve the ecology.

 

EV Design Course Overview

A course on electric vehicle design typically covers a wide array of topics, a lot of which is unique to any other automotive design course. It pertains to the in-depth understanding of the design and development of electric vehicles. While the foundational basis for vehicle design and its core concepts remain the same, EV design also offers lessons on powertrains, battery design, chassis design, thermal management, aerodynamics, etc.

Studying vehicle architecture is also part of an EV course. It is incredibly different from other car designs due to the uniqueness associated with an electric vehicle. Components such as the drivetrain have to be integrated into the chassis, weight distribution has to be balanced, and lightweight materials such as aluminum and carbon fiber are extensively employed to construct the vehicle. These play a vital part in the electric vehicle design course.

Apart from that, aerodynamics, control, energy management, and sustainability are always going to be vital components of an electric vehicle design course. EV design will remain a part of automotive design or transportation design and will become the need of the hour in the future.

EV Design Course Syllabus

Although the course syllabus for electric design might vary from one institution to another, here are some of the core concepts that are part of any electric vehicle design course:

1. Electric Storage Solutions

It covers areas such as the design of batteries, charging areas, and the overall battery pack.

2. Aerodynamics

Elements from automotive design and EV standards are taught as part of this. Aspects such as low-drag design features and underbody design are part of this.

3. Safety Regulations

Safety concerning environmental and performance levels is part of this subject.

4. Architecture Modelling

EV architecture such as powertrain development techniques and system development models are part of this topic.

5. Control Unit

The functioning of the Control Unit, software, hardware, data management, and other development processes are part of this topic.

Several other subjects such as EV subsystems, Power and Torque, Drive Cycles, State of Charge (SoC) and State of Health (SoH), Thermal Design, etc., are part of the course syllabus too.

 

Admission Procedure for Electric Vehicle Design Course

To pursue a career in electric vehicle design, one needs to get admission into an automotive design or transportation design course from a reputable design school like the Strate School of Design.

The process starts with securing 50% or more marks in Class 12 and applying for a design school of choice. They need to clear the admission test specific to each institution and then clear the interview or portfolio review.

Once they clear all rounds, they can get admission into the college and pursue their course. If any student wants to pursue an Masters further in their career, they need to secure 50% or more marks in their graduation, and only then they can apply for it.

UCEED (Undergraduate Common Entrance Examination for Design) and AIEED (All India Entrance Examination for Design) are two of the common entrance tests for design colleges in India.

How is the EV Job Market?

The electric vehicle design job market is a rapidly expanding one in this era of globalization. Many luminaries like Elon Musk have already touted electric vehicles are the future of transportation. It will not only be cost-effective in the future but is also a major measure to combat environmental pollution. Therefore, there has been a huge uptick in the demand for skilled professionals in electric vehicles.

Those in design engineering, battery management systems, software development systems, and sales departments, are constantly in demand. This is due to the global adoption of EVs by the common folk.

India’s Road Transport and Highways Minister Nitin Gadkari claimed that the Indian EV market will rise to INR 20,00,000 crores by the year 2030, as per a report by Economic Times. It would also create 5 million direct jobs and 30 million indirect jobs.

Professionals such as design engineers, software engineers, EV test engineers, and sales and marketing specialists, will be the leading job-takers in the EV market. The main reason behind this aggressive development of the EV market can be attributed to government policies, technological advancements, and infrastructure development, among others.
